1. What is Manufactured Sand (M-sand)?

Manufactured sand (M-sand) is finely crushed rock, produced from hard granite stone by crushing. It is a cost-effective and eco-friendly alternative to river sand.

2. How is M-sand produced?

M-sand is produced by crushing rocks to specific sizes and then washing these crushed stones to remove any impurities.

3. What are the advantages of using M-sand?

M-sand boasts numerous benefits, including better workability, high concrete strength, and improved durability compared to natural sand.

4. What equipment is needed in a manufactured sand plant?

Essential equipment includes crushers, screens, washing systems, and conveyors.

5. What types of crushers are used in M-sand production?

Common types are jaw crushers, cone crushers, and impact crushers.

6. Is M-sand suitable for all types of construction?

Yes, M-sand is suitable for both concrete and mortar applications.

7. How does the cost of M-sand compare to natural sand?

M-sand is usually more cost-effective due to lower transportation costs and consistent availability.

8. What is the impact of M-sand on the environment?

M-sand is more environmentally friendly as it reduces the need for river sand, thereby minimizing riverbed erosion and ecosystem disruption.

9. What are the quality standards for M-sand?

M-sand must meet the standards set by IS 383 and other relevant regulations to ensure its suitability for construction.

10. Can M-sand be used in high-strength concrete?

Yes, M-sand can be used in high-strength concrete as it has excellent physical properties.

11. What is the water absorption rate of M-sand?

Typically, the water absorption rate of M-sand is around 2-2.5%.

12. Does M-sand require any additional processing after crushing?

Yes, M-sand often requires washing to remove micro-fines and improve quality.

13. What are micro-fines in M-sand?

Micro-fines are ultra-fine particles that can affect the quality and performance of concrete.

14. How can you test the quality of M-sand?

Quality tests include particle size distribution, specific gravity, bulk density, and silt content analysis.

15. Can M-sand replace natural sand entirely?

Yes, with proper quality control, M-sand can fully replace natural sand in concrete and mortar applications.

16. What are the storage requirements for M-sand?

M-sand should be stored in a covered and dry area to prevent contamination.

17. Is M-sand available year-round?

Yes, M-sand is manufactured and available throughout the year, offering consistent supply irrespective of seasonal changes.

18. What are the by-products of M-sand manufacturing?

The main by-products are quarry dust and crushed rock fines.

19. How to ensure the perfect gradation in M-sand?

Using advanced screening and washing systems can ensure the perfect gradation in M-sand.

20. What is the role of washing in M-sand production?

Washing helps remove impurities and micro-fines, enhancing the overall quality of the manufactured sand.

21. Can recycled concrete aggregate (RCA) be mixed with M-sand?

Yes, RCA can be mixed with M-sand for specific applications, ensuring quality is maintained.

22. How long does the M-sand production process take?

The production time varies based on the plant's capacity and setup, but generally, it’s a continuous process.

23. Are there any certifications required for M-sand plants?

Yes, M-sand plants usually need to comply with local regulations and certify their product quality as per IS 383.

24. How do mineral characteristics impact M-sand quality?

Mineral characteristics like hardness and strength of the parent rock affect the quality of M-sand.

25. Can M-sand be used in plastering?

Yes, specially graded M-sand can be used for plastering.

26. How is M-sand different from crusher dust?

M-sand is specifically graded to meet construction standards, whereas crusher dust may not meet those standards.

27. What is the role of granulation in M-sand?

Granulation ensures that the sand particles are of uniform size and texture, essential for quality construction.

28. How sustainable is M-sand?

M-sand is a sustainable option as it reduces reliance on natural sand and minimizes environmental impact.

29. What are the challenges in manufacturing M-sand?

Challenges include maintaining consistent quality, controlling micro-fine content, and ensuring environmental compliance.

30. How do you ensure the consistency of M-sand quality?

Regular quality checks and adherence to standards ensure the consistency of M-sand quality.

31. What is the future of M-sand in construction?

With increasing environmental regulations and depletion of natural sand resources, M-sand is poised to become the preferred choice in construction.
